In today's digital age, slow data transfers can significantly hinder your productivity and overall experience online. Factors such as poor internet connection, outdated hardware, and network congestion can all contribute to a sluggish data transfer speed. To determine whether your data transfer is slowing you down, start by running a speed test and comparing the results with your internet plan's promised speeds. If there's a considerable gap, it's time to investigate further.
Fortunately, there are several ways to fix slow data transfers. First, consider upgrading your internet plan or switching to a more reliable provider. Additionally, ensure your router is up to date and positioned in a central location for optimal coverage. You might also want to limit the number of connected devices and close unnecessary applications that use bandwidth. Lastly, using a wired connection instead of Wi-Fi can also enhance your data transfer speeds, providing a more stable and faster experience.
